Sources: Google launching a new Nest Hub in 2021 that uses Soli for sleep tracking

Google is planning to release a new Nest Hub in 2021, sources familiar with the matter tell 9to5Google. This upcoming Smart Display will feature sleep tracking powered by the company’s Soli radar technology. Google changing the tone that plays when Casting to Nest Hubs, speakers

When you Cast to a Smart Display or speaker, Google plays a tone to confirm the transfer. Google is now changing that beep to be softer on the latest Nest Hub preview firmware. The current Cast beep has been in place for several years — if not unchanged from the beginning — and is quite deep. iPhone 12 component costs are $431, 26% up on the iPhone 11 – Counterpoint

Counterpoint research has put together an estimate of the iPhone 12 component costs in a so-called Bill of Materials (BOM) analysis. It estimates that Apple’s total cost for materials for the US version of the middle-tier base model iPhone 12 is $431 – 26% up on the iPhone 11.
